Midnight & Haunted Shelf Guide

Midnight exploration unlocks around the Helping Ticket milestone after you obtain the Ghost Shelf at Mukoutsuji. It does not necessarily happen every night. The shelf can host control items that influence anomaly behavior, but a Wood Plaque is not automatically a same-night guarantee.

The short answer

Unlock through story progression and the shelf. Use plaques to influence a matching anomaly when a Midnight session applies. Use Purifying Salt for the documented anti-anomaly shelf effect. Remember: 05:00 is an encounter boundary, 06:00 is forced return.

Session model

Midnight is a session, not one single anomaly

Story, random and controlled sessions can share the Midnight time window while using different conditions.

Story

Scripted progression may use Midnight. A shelf item should not be described as overriding or blocking required story progression without direct evidence.

Random

Some sessions and encounters are random or condition-based. No percentage, fixed cycle or best sleep-spam method is published.

Controlled

A plaque can influence a matching anomaly when the relevant Midnight session applies. It does not prove that Midnight starts that night.

Weather is context, not the trigger: Rain, Thunderstorm and Snow can gate individual anomaly content. They do not automatically create a Midnight session.

Purifying Salt

Safety control, not a permanent switch

The item description is precise enough to guide use, but not to justify extra mechanics.

What is confirmed

Purifying Salt is a Shrine item recipe. The current description says it is placed on the Ghost Shelf to prevent midnight anomaly events.

The Workbench material baseline is Salt ×1 and Rock Salt ×1. The Shrine cost is owned by the Skills guide, not duplicated as a second skill tree here.

What is not confirmed

  • Whether it prevents waking, suppresses only anomalies or affects a whole session.
  • Whether it is consumed, persistent, removable or replaceable.
  • Whether it can block a required story Midnight.
  • How it interacts with a plaque if both controls could be placed.

Time boundaries

05:00 is not 06:00

Use the separate times when planning a Midnight route.

Start

Exact start time unknown

The current repository does not establish a precise clock time for the beginning of a Midnight session.

05:00

Many anomalies disappear

Many ghost or dangerous encounters disappear around this time. It is not the formal end for every entity.

06:00

Forced return home

The session ends and the player is automatically returned home. No money, item, stamina or Friendship penalty is asserted.

Dog Whistle is unavailable

The Dog Whistle cannot be used during Midnight exploration. You can keep walking while the session remains active, then the 06:00 boundary returns you home automatically. Other whistles are not generalized from this restriction.

Restrictions

Season, story and weather still matter

A control item does not automatically bypass the conditions attached to the target anomaly.

Tengu

The current anomaly record is Summer onward. The Tengu plaque is not published as a Spring bypass.

Tengu guide

Nodzuchi

The current anomaly record is Summer onward. Keep the seasonal condition separate from the plaque relationship.

Nodzuchi guide

Rain

Karakasa is a Rain-gated Midnight puzzle. Rain does not itself trigger Midnight.

Weather guide

Snow / storm

Yuki-onna uses Snow; Fujin and Raijin use Thunderstorm. See the anomaly authorities for solutions.

FAQ

Midnight system questions

When does Midnight unlock?

Midnight becomes available around the Helping Ticket milestone after the Ghost Shelf is obtained at Mukoutsuji. Year 1 Spring 16 is a reference point, not a replacement for the story conditions.

Does Midnight happen every night?

No. After unlock, eligible Midnight sessions are not guaranteed every night. The current data does not establish a probability or fixed cycle.

How do I get the Haunted Shelf?

The repository's canonical furniture label is Ghost Shelf, Japanese お化け棚, Catalog No.2305. It is obtained through the first Midnight progression around the Helping Ticket stage at Mukoutsuji.

Do Wood Plaques force Midnight tonight?

Do not assume that they do. A plaque influences its matching anomaly when a Midnight session applies, but the current evidence does not prove a same-night Midnight guarantee.

What happens if I place a plaque and wake in the morning?

The current public model does not promise that the plaque is consumed or that a session is forced. Treat persistence and exact consumption timing as unresolved unless your current game behavior confirms it.

What does Purifying Salt do?

The canonical Shrine description says it is placed on the Ghost Shelf to prevent midnight anomaly events. This page does not turn that wording into a permanent disable, a guaranteed whole-session block or a story-progression override.

When do anomalies disappear?

Many active ghost or dangerous encounters disappear around 05:00, while 06:00 is the hard exploration end and forced return home. These times are separate.

Can I use Dog Whistle during Midnight?

No. The Dog Whistle return shortcut is unavailable during Midnight exploration. The game forces you home at 06:00, and no extra penalty is asserted.

Does weather cause Midnight?

No. Rain, Thunderstorm and Snow can gate individual anomaly or item content, but weather is not itself published as the Midnight trigger.
